Output e7915eddfbc1c2fe3e5c99433df12e8a1257f49891504bbd7af44468eae18f31:3

value
2046284
script pubkey
OP_0 OP_PUSHBYTES_20 0b6f39d6b4a0e86f0e7149b9b95ac4a924deee92
address
bc1qpdhnn4455r5x7rn3fxumjkky4yjdam5j28w4zf
transaction
e7915eddfbc1c2fe3e5c99433df12e8a1257f49891504bbd7af44468eae18f31
confirmations
183096
spent
true